Once when hiking I found the skeleton of what was once a large vibrant living animal. The only thing remaining were its dry bones and of course, there was no reason for alarm for it presented no danger to me. It was dead with no possibility of it being able to come to life and harm me. As humans we do not have the power to bring back to life dry bones and the Lord used this to illustrate the complete inability for any human to bring spiritual life to the spiritually dead soul, dearth of the dew of heaven and the springs of living waters.
Though we are called to cooperate with the Divine, whether preaching the word or lending a helping hand to someone in need, it is only by the power of the Spirit of God that spiritual life is awakened and brought to life in the soul. If you feel like you are going through a spiritual drought or even worse like you have lost your way spiritually take the counsel of the Lord Himself. “O dry bones, hear the word of the Lord”. Ezekiel 37:4 Paul writes, “For the word of God is living and powerful” Hebrews 4:12. When we listen to God speak it is life to our bones. He is the One who spoke the world into existence and He can speak life into our spiritual life.
